What's Changed
- Add validation to ensure valid moduleCode by @yadunut in #123
- Fix TOC link in UG by @AdityaB4 in #125
- Add OS Specific instructions for setup by @AdityaB4 in #129
- Match data filename with advertised behaviour by @AdityaB4 in #128
- Update delete_timing ug description by @AdityaB4 in #127
- docs: add add module timing implementation to dg by @blaukc in #133
- test: add tests for parser by @blaukc in #132
- fix: add validation for find_free_time by @blaukc in #131
- fix: error message in find_free_time not matching UG by @blaukc in #134
- fix: fix incorrect parameters error different from UG by @blaukc in #138
- docs: Add documentation by @taufiq in #145
- Add list_modules, module_search description by @yadunut in #143
- Update previously missed json edit by @AdityaB4 in #146
- docs: add case sensitivity text for DAY by @blaukc in #137
- Update user guide images by @AdityaB4 in #147
- Add tutorials and fix image paths by @yadunut in #148
- Fix UG links by @blaukc in #151
- Cite AI use under DG acknowledgements by @AdityaB4 in #142
- fix: Remove text truncation for
list_modules
by @taufiq in #135 - Add Planned Enhancements appendix by @AdityaB4 in #144
- Add Module timing clash test by @AdityaB4 in #150
- Increase test coverage for module models by @AdityaB4 in #149
- Update docs to explain tags can not process white spaces by @AdityaB4 in #126
- fix example command by @blaukc in #152
- Add annotated ui with explanation by @AdityaB4 in #154
- Add filtering information by @AdityaB4 in #155
- Fix tables by @AdityaB4 in #156
- Add
delete_timing
implementation and sequence diag by @AdityaB4 in #158 - Fix DG links by @blaukc in #157
- Update DG to match internal docs and UG by @AdityaB4 in #159
- Misc UG fixes by @blaukc in #161
- [DG]: Update ModuleMapStorage by @yadunut in #153
- Add untracked puml for delete_timing diagram by @AdityaB4 in #162
- docs: Add FindFreeTimeSequenceDiagram to DG by @taufiq in #160
Full Changelog: v1.3.0...v1.4